1. MODELING AND SIMULATION OF FRACTAL ANTENNA AT 7.5GHz FOR MILITARY SATELLITE COMMUNICATION APPLICATIONS
A fractal antenna is self-similar structure and symmetrical that has been constructed at 7.5GHz for military satellite communication applications. The space filling capability of the fractal structures is used to effectively distribute the surface current all over the radiating material. The proposed fractal antenna structure is composed of copper sheets (Patch and Ground Plane) placed on both sides of a dielectric substrate Roger RT Duroid with permittivity =2.2.The antenna is fed with lambda by 4 to a microstrip patch antenna. The fractal antenna is simulated and optimized by High Frequency Structure Simulator (HFSS) software.
2. 8 Channel Quiz Buzzer using Micro Controller
The Microcontroller 8 Channel Quiz Buzzer Circuit is a simple embedded system with a set of 8 push buttons as input devices, a microcontroller as the main controller, and a buzzer and a display as output devices.
A microcontroller performs the entire operation using a programme written in C and dumped inside the microcontroller. The buzzer starts ringing when one of the buttons is pressed, and the associated number is displayed on the 7 segment display.
